Jonathan Huberdeau only had one thread made about him this year and I rarely see his name mentioned in threads. Yet he finished 12th in points ahead of players like Scheifele, Giroux, Ovechkin, Panarin, Tavares and Wheeler while having a higher PPG.

Alex DeBrincat 41 goals, 35 assists, 76 points, a buck over 17 minutes avg ice time / game
- from 30 & 40 (50) goal scorers he had the least ice time per game.

He did get plenty of ice time more what to his rookie season; from 14 minutes to 17 minutes,
next season hoping for at least 20 minutes avg of ice time.

- it would be foolish not to expect 50 goal, 90-100 point season from him

From the sophomore's, Alex was by far the best,
1. DeBrincat: 76 points, 2. Connor: 66 points, 3. Barzal: 62 points, 4. Dubois: 61 points, 5. Strome: 57 points
